XIX. Discussion of the magnetical observations made by captain Back, R. N. during his late arctic expedition
Previous to Captain Back’s departure in 1833 with the expedition for the relief of Captain Ross, he consulted me respecting the nature of the magnetical observations which I considered it desirable should be made in the regions he was likely to visit.
